Schema Reference

Complete specification for LoKO catalog workload definitions.

Workloads are defined using YAML and validated against Pydantic models. This reference covers all available fields and their usage.


Root workload definition in catalog files.

FieldTypeRequiredDescription
typestringYessystem or user
categorystringNoWorkload category (database, cache, messaging, etc.)
descriptionstringYesBrief description
chartobjectYesHelm chart configuration
defaultsobjectNoDefault values for namespace, ports, storage
mappingsobjectNoMap config values to Helm chart paths
secretsarrayNoSecret generation specifications
presetsobjectNoPre-configured Helm values (system workloads only)
endpointsarrayNoService endpoint definitions
connection-stringsarrayNoConnection string templates
health-checksarrayNoHealth check definitions
linksarrayNoRelated workload links
hooksarrayNoHelmfile lifecycle hooks

Default configuration values.

defaults:
namespace: loko-workloads # Default namespace
ports: [5432, 8080] # TCP ports to expose
storage:
size: 10Gi # Default storage size

Port Requirements:

  • HTTP services: No ports needed (use Traefik ingress)
  • TCP services: Ports dynamically configured via HAProxy tunnel

Automatic secret generation specifications.

secrets:
- name: password
type: password
length: 16
charset: alphanum # alphanum | alpha | numeric | hex
description: "Database password"
secrets:
admin:
name: admin
type: user-pass
description: "Admin credentials"
fields:
- name: username
type: static
value: admin
sensitive: false
- name: password
type: password
length: 16
mappings:
username: gitea.admin.username
password: gitea.admin.password
TypeDescriptionFields
passwordAlphanumeric passwordlength
hexHex-encoded secretlength (in bytes)
tokenToken with custom charsetlength, charset
uuidUUID4 stringnone
staticStatic valuevalue

Note: user-pass is a CredentialSet type (containing multiple fields), not a field type.

Service endpoint definitions for documentation.

endpoints:
- name: client # Endpoint name
protocol: tcp # tcp | http | https
port: 5432 # Port number
host: "postgres.${LOKO_DOMAIN}" # Optional host
description: "PostgreSQL client port"

Protocols:

  • tcp - Raw TCP connections
  • http - HTTP without TLS
  • https - HTTP with TLS

Template-based connection string generation.

connection-strings:
- name: default
template: "postgresql://postgres:${PASSWORD}@${HOST}:5432/${DB}"
- name: jdbc
template: "jdbc:postgresql://${HOST}:5432/${DB}?user=postgres&password=${PASSWORD}"
- name: url
template: "https://${HOST}"

Available Variables:

  • ${HOST} - Service hostname
  • ${PASSWORD} - Generated password
  • ${USER} - Username
  • ${DB} - Database name
  • ${PORT} - Port number
  • ${LOKO_DOMAIN} - Local domain

Service health verification definitions.

health-checks:
- name: port
type: tcp
port: 5432
tier: infrastructure # Default tier (no client tools required)
description: "Check if port is open"
health-checks:
- name: web-ui
type: http
target: web # Reference to endpoint
path: /health
tier: infrastructure
description: "Check web UI health"
health-checks:
- name: ready
type: command
tier: client # Requires client tools
image: postgres:15-alpine
command: ["pg_isready", "-h", "${HOST}", "-p", "5432"]
requires: ["pg_isready"]
description: "PostgreSQL ready check"

Check Types:

  • tcp - TCP port connectivity
  • http - HTTP endpoint response
  • command - Run command in container

Health Check Tiers:

  • infrastructure - Port connectivity checks (no client tools required, runs by default)
  • client - Service validation using client tools (requires installing tools like mysql, psql, etc.)

Define relationships between workloads.

links:
- type: addon
target: postgres-ui # Linked workload name
auto-deploy: true # Deploy automatically
required: false # Optional addon
lifecycle-binding: true # Delete when parent deleted
links:
- type: dependent
target: database # Required dependency
auto-deploy: true
required: true
wait-for-ready: true # Wait until ready

Link Types:

  • addon - UI or utility workload
  • dependent - Required dependency
  • sidecar - Co-deployed service
  • extension - Optional extension

Helmfile lifecycle hooks for custom actions.

hooks:
- events: ["presync"] # presync | postsync | preuninstall
show-logs: true # Show hook output
command: "/bin/bash"
args:
- "-c"
- |
set -e
echo "Running pre-sync hook..."
# Custom commands here

Available Events:

  • presync - Before Helm install/upgrade
  • postsync - After Helm install/upgrade
  • preuninstall - Before Helm uninstall

Environment Variables:

  • $LOKO_KUBECTL_CONTEXT - Kubernetes context
  • $LOKO_DOMAIN - Local domain
  • $NAMESPACE - Workload namespace

Variables available in workload definitions.

VariableExampleDescription
${LOKO_DOMAIN}dev.meLocal domain
${LOKO_APPS_DOMAIN}dev.meApps domain
${LOKO_IP}192.168.0.10Local IP address
${LOKO_ENV_NAME}localEnvironment name
${LOKO_REGISTRY_NAME}zotRegistry name
${LOKO_REGISTRY_HOST}registry.dev.meRegistry host
${LOKO_SYSTEM_WORKLOADS_NAMESPACE}loko-workloadsSystem namespace
${LOKO_KUBECTL_CONTEXT}loko-localkubectl context

All workload definitions are validated using Pydantic models in the LoKO CLI.

Validation includes:

  • Required fields presence
  • Type checking (strings, integers, lists, objects)
  • Port number ranges (1-65535)
  • Version string format
  • Template variable syntax
  • Chart repository existence
  • Circular dependency detection

Common Errors:

# ❌ Invalid - missing required fields
workloads:
myapp:
chart:
repo: groundhog2k
# ✅ Valid - all required fields
workloads:
myapp:
type: system
description: "My app"
chart:
repo: groundhog2k
name: groundhog2k/nextcloud
version: "0.20.6"
